uPVC stands for Unplasticised polyvinyl chloride. It is a low maintenance building material that has been used to replace painted timber windows in countless homes. uPVC is invulnerable to mould and rot as well as corrosion. This makes it a perfect material for frames, sills, and doors.

Professional uPVC repairs can help to restore the energy efficiency, functionality and security of your home. This could involve moving or lubricating the mechanism and components.

Window lock repair

Window lock repair is a typical household issue. With the right tools and know-how, it's simple to fix. It's time to contact an expert if you're unable to secure your windows. This service can assist you in returning to normal in a matter of minutes. It will also ensure that your home is safe from intruders.

If you have a window that is difficult to open or close it could be due to the mechanism for locking is damaged or stuck. This can be fixed by cleaning the mechanism and applying lubricant onto the locks. If you're not sure how to do this yourself and are in need of help, a local uPVC company can assist. They'll also make sure that the window is in alignment with its frame and fix any loose bolts or screws.

A damaged window lock can be an issue, particularly when it prevents you to enjoy the view from your home. There are a few different ways to fix it, including replacement and renovation. You can either replace the lock, or just the handle. It is usually cheaper to replace the handle, rather than the entire window.

window doctor near me sill repair

Even though window sills aren't the most visible element of a window, they still play an important role in a home's appearance. They're also extremely exposed to the elements, and they are susceptible to being damaged. There are many ways to repair window sills. The first step is assessing the damage. Check for cracks or splits that extend beyond the surface. Wood glue can be used to fill small gaps however larger gaps will require to be filled. It's a good idea look for large chunks of concrete are missing as well.

This usually indicates that there is a bigger problem that needs more extensive repairs or replacement. For instance, if cracks have expanded and there are large pieces missing, it could be time to think about replacing the entire window sill.

It is essential to have the right tools before you begin. To take down the old sill, you'll need a utility knife, putty knives mallet or hammer an chisel and a pry-bar. It is best to be careful to avoid damaging the window's frame.

After removing the old sill, it is crucial to clean any mould or rot that may have grown on the frame. If you don't get rid of it, it could continue to expand. This could result in more damage. You can make use of a paint scraper to scrape off any caulk or paint that's been damaged by the decay.

In the end, you must apply a new coat of paint on the window sill. Fill any gaps left window doctor near me spray foam to ensure a secure seal. Make use of a sander and sandpaper to smooth out the surface of your sill.

Wood is the most popular material used for window repairs near me sills. However, there are also some made of stone and tile. Wooden sills are painted or stained to make them more resistant to the elements, whereas stone and tile sills are more durable and don't require any special care. It's important to maintain your windowsills in order to avoid damage from water and other issues.

Window frame repair

The frames, sills and sashes of windows are important elements of a home. They hold glass in place and provide insulation. However, they could be damaged or worn out over time. These issues can cause draughts, mould, and other issues, and they need to be repaired as quickly as possible.

Examine the frame and sills to check for any damage. Look for evidence of rot or moisture. If you see any, it's best to contact a professional for repairs as soon as possible. The longer you put off the worse it will get.

Moisture in the window frames and in walls can cause decay. This isn't only unsightly, but it is also a health risk to those who suffer from asthma or respiratory issues. Moisture may also cause leaks that are difficult to spot. It could be caused by the leak of water in a different part of the home or faulty window frames.

Window-Repairs.-150x150.jpgIf the frames are wood, it's recommended to have them painted or stained regularly. This will help them withstand the elements and extend their lifespan. It is also essential to check for damages regularly and replace the hardware when necessary. If you notice that your windows are stuck or have difficulty opening or closing then it's time to get an expert.

Over time, all wooden windows will require maintenance. This may include repairing cracks or splits. The elements, such as heat and sun, can affect them too. Wood is prone to insect damage and rot, so it's best to get it replaced or repaired as soon as you notice any damage.

Repairing wooden window frames can be costly, but it's usually cheaper than replacing them. The cost of a repair job is dependent on the extent of the damage and the materials used. A repair job on a wooden window typically costs between $175 and $300 for a window. Aluminum frames are more affordable but are still susceptible to being damaged. Temperature changes can cause them to crack or bend, which could result in the loss of the sealant that is required to protect against weather.

French door repair

French doors are a beautiful addition to any home. They provide a view of the outside and let in plenty of sunlight. But, just like any other window or door, they can be prone to damage from weather and wear and tear. It is important to fix these issues as soon as you can. They can range from minor problems to major ones. Most repairs are easy and cost-effective.

The most common problem with french doors is that they don't close properly. This could be due to a number of things such as misalignment or poor installation. To address the issue, simply close the door and check for any obstructions that could hinder it from closing. Then, align the door and then close it to ensure that it is functioning properly.

The latch can also become stuck on french doors. This can be a nagging issue because it can hinder the doors from being opened and closed. To fix this issue, you can change the oil in the lock or replace the latch. However, if you're not comfortable working on your French doors, it is recommended to speak with an expert for assistance.

Finally, French doors may be damaged by moisture or decay. This occurs when the finish of the wood deteriorates and allows moisture to enter the pores. This can cause the wood to expand and contract, resulting in decay. If not treated, the decay can be spread to the rest of the wood. However, this kind of damage is not always permanent and can be fixed by using a resin glue that is absorbed into the wood and becomes as hard like glass.
